MetricManager.LaunchTaskError
An error that describes a problem that occurred while tracking an extended launch task.
Declaration
struct LaunchTaskErrorMentioned in
Discussion
LaunchTaskError is delivered to the onTrackingError closure passed to trackLaunchTask(id:onTrackingError:_:) or trackLaunchTask(id:onTrackingError:_:). Inspect reason to determine the cause:
await manager.trackLaunchTask(id: "initial-data-load", onTrackingError: { error in
print("Tracking error for \(error.taskID): \(error.reason)")
}) {
await loadInitialData()
}